Integrated Approaches to Risk, Resilience, and Preparedness: Insights from C2IMPRESS & MEDiate Projects

To mitigate the natural disaster-induced multi-hazard risks, the Co-Creative Improved Understanding and Awareness of Multi-Hazard Risks for Disaster Resilient Society (C2IMPRESS) and the Multi-hazard and risk informed system for Enhanced local and regional Disaster risk management (MEDiate) projects were introduced 3 years ago. These EU-funded projects have leveraged the idea of developing a joint task force, where local people, administrations, experts, and other stakeholders are interconnected with a common platform; thus, identifying and addressing a risk can be accomplished more easily and effectively. As the projects will be closing on September 30, 2025, a webinar has been arranged as one of the closing activities of the projects. 

The C2IMPRESS project is ready to provide a better understanding and public awareness of multi-hazard risks, the associated multidimensional impacts, vulnerabilities and resilience of extreme weather events, including their origins and the aftermath. On the other hand, the MEDiate project will start contributing to enhance the existing assessment systems of disaster risks and to improve disaster risk management and governance.

This webinar will play a pivotal role for both ends. Through the sessions, the project representatives will demonstrate their systems to the mass audience. And the participants will briefly know about the projects along with the tools and methodologies that have been developed for disaster preparedness, such as the decision support system (DSS), Citizen Engagement Platform, hazard monitor app, etc. They can witness the natural disaster risk management systems live from the projects.
